AI Transcription and Facial Recognition: Why States Need Clear Guardrails
This policy tip sheet examines the rapid growth of artificial intelligence tools used for transcription, surveillance, and facial recognition, highlighting the significant constitutional and privacy concerns these technologies raise. It explains that AI’s ability to record, analyze, and interpret human communication—often without consent or oversight—poses a serious threat to Americans’ Fourth Amendment protections.
